Output 95a9053762dd755d150416157e1ba403c4c733d705e0159f83a55389d8ab8ccc:122

value
304341
script pubkey
OP_0 OP_PUSHBYTES_20 fc7c8af90a2f3e763ebc0668b145f46743dc92c3
address
bc1ql37g47g29ul8v04uqe5tz305vapaeykr56pex7
transaction
95a9053762dd755d150416157e1ba403c4c733d705e0159f83a55389d8ab8ccc
confirmations
119495
spent
true